Nombre: 111934478
Country: United Kingdom
Source: gov.uk Contracts Finder
Nombre: 74391031
Nombre: 1157464
Source: Welsh procurement portal
Nombre: 1157465
Nombre: 1157466
Nombre: 1157467
Nombre: 1157468
Nombre: 1157469